Flyway scripts

WebMar 27, 2016 · We can specify execution order of versioned migration scripts simply by setting version number. But I didn't find any way to sort execution of repeatable migration … WebJan 12, 2015 · You can use flyway placeholder: Configure it on your enviroment config.properties: flyway.placeholders. tableName =MY_TABLE flyway.placeholders. name ='Mr. Test' Then, put it on your script: INSERT INTO $ {tableName} (name) VALUES ( $ {name} ); I have used the flyway.locations too, but the placeholders is simpler than …

How to set Flyway migration file location using Spring profiles

WebTo achieve migrations, Flyway uses so-called migration scripts. Migrations scripts are "sequentially ordered SQL scripts" that incrementally migrate your schema. ... By this … WebMar 21, 2024 · Our development team is currently hard at work improving the advanced capabilities in Flyway, such as allowing database developers to maintains a version … binding of isaac rebirth stats https://bigalstexasrubs.com

Implementing Flyway with Docker - Medium

WebApr 12, 2024 · Can flyway run a script for more than 20 hours? jamal1 Posts: 1 New member. April 12, 2024 5:40PM. I was using flyway to run a script in mariadb, flyway was timing out after 4 hours, this script has to run for 25 hours to complete the changes, is there something i need to fix so that flyway does not time out. Tagged: flyway. WebOct 11, 2024 · In the Flyway Desktop Version Control tab, you can keep track of your database scripts in version control and share your changes with the rest of your team.This is done through integration with Git.In this tab you can: Pull commits made by your team members into your local repository from the remote. These migration scripts can then be … WebExtract flyway (you must install java). tar zxvf flyway-commandline-4.1.2-linux-x64.tar.gz Go to flyway cd flyway-4.1.2 Config in /conf/flyway.conf flyway.url=jdbc:h2:file:./foobardb flyway.user=SA flyway.password= Creating the empty migrations in the /sql directory called Vx__xxxxxx.sql select 1; binding of isaac rebirth the razor

Best practice: How to modify flyway migration script after it …

Category:One Flyway Migration Script for Diverse Database Systems

Tags:Flyway scripts

Flyway scripts

java - How to create a database with flyway? - Stack Overflow

WebSpring boot flyway framework is basically used to update database versions using migration tools. We can write a flyway database migration script using SQL or a java programming language. Flyway is the tool which was allowing incremental changes of version control in our database. Recommended Articles This is a guide to the spring boot flyway. WebNov 28, 2024 · This migration script is a simple Flyway version script, and its version will be the version of the first migration scripts that we squash. In most cases, when we squash all the migration scripts ...

Flyway scripts

Did you know?

Web"With Flyway you can combine the full power of SQL with solid versioning. This makes setting up and maintaining database schemas a breeze . We use it across all environments including production, making it a perfect fit … WebJan 7, 2024 · These provide information such as the date when Flyway ran a script, the database name, username, and the location of the flyway schema history table. In the Flyway.conf file, you can also define your own placeholders and configure the value for these placeholders using, for example, flyway.placeholders.superuser=Philip J Factor.

WebThe code in this repository allows for: Generation of a script that can be run manually by DBAs. Utilizes existing Flyway scripts to make the content of the generated script. … WebMay 2, 2024 · Flyway, as stated before, organizes its scripts based on the numeric part of the naming pattern. As this will be our first script, we will create the file naming it as V1__customers.sql . The ...

WebSep 29, 2016 · Database Migrations with Flyway. 1. Introduction. In this tutorial, we'll explore key concepts of Flyway and how we can use this framework to continuously … WebNov 16, 2024 · Script migrations. Flyway Teams. Sometimes it may be more desirable to use a scripting language for migrations. Flyway Teams currently supports the .ps1, .bat, .cmd, .sh, .bash, .py file extensions as migrations, and on non-windows platforms it also supports migrations without extensions (assuming a valid shebang).

WebApr 12, 2024 · Flyway Desktop Baseline – A script that has the structure and code of all objects that exist in the target database (s). We can create a baseline script for Flyway, …

WebFlyway by Redgate Database Migrations Made Easy. Evolve your database schema easily and reliably across all your instances. Simple, focused and powerful. Works on Windows, macOS, Linux, Docker and Java … binding of isaac rebirth unblockedWebFeb 16, 2024 · Flyway creates the “dry run” script by executing the entire migration run, including the placeholder substitutions. In this example, one migration file is only executed if the server-version is high enough, and this decision is controlled by a placeholder. binding of isaac rebirth the hermitWebAug 25, 2024 · This is a parameter of the Flyway migrate command, telling it that the location (s) of the files it is to run. filesystem refers to the filesystem on the Docker container. This can be a list of locations, comma-separated and case-sensitive. Even if you store your files into multiple locations, Flyway still executes them in version order. binding of isaac rebirth the chariotWebOct 22, 2024 · Flyway selects the Baseline Migration script nearest to the version of the database that you specify and then executes every subsequent migration file. Creating a baseline migration script A baseline migration script is possibly better imagined as a migration script that goes from zero to the version. binding of isaac rebirth the negativeWebFlyway is an open-source database migration tool. It strongly favors simplicity and convention over configuration. It is based around just 7 basic commands: Migrate , Clean … binding of isaac recycling deskWebAug 22, 2024 · Flyway Undo scripts revert a database from a specific version to a previous version. In other words, it has a securely defined start point. This also means that we can chain undo scripts together to move back several versions at once. There is plenty of use for a Flyway undo script, particularly when working in an isolated branch, but it won ... binding of isaac red eyeWebMar 28, 2016 · 23. Repeatable scripts appear to be controlled by the name following the R__ suffix, first numeric, then alpha upper case, then alpha lower case. Instead of being run just once, they are (re-)applied every time their checksum changes. Within a single migration run, repeatable migrations are always applied last, after all pending versioned ... binding of isaac rebirth tips